Abstract

The Bajocian ammonite faunas of the ‘Oberer Blaukalk’ Member (Wedelsandstein Formation) and of the lower part of the ‘Humphriesioolith’ Member (Gosheim Formation) in the vicinity of Gosheim (SW Swabian Alb) are studied. At least three biohorizons of the Sauzei Zone can be distinguished: dilatus, pseudocontrahens, macrum and ?carinodiscus biohorizon, probably followed by the deltafalcata biohorizon of the basal Humphriesianum Zone (Pinguis Subzone). This succession is correlated with other sites in SW Germany and abroad.
